Apple calls for crusade against fragmented Android
 
Top Apple church leader and marketing chief Phil Schiller has ordered a crusade against Google's fragmented Android - claiming that only Jobs' Mob can bring the sort of unity that the world desperately needs.

Speaking before Samsung takes the wraps off its latest flagship smartphone, Schiller said that Google's own research showed the vast majority of Android users were stuck on older versions of the software, and that Samsung's new phone itself may debut with a year old operating system that will need updating.

According to Stuff, Schiller said that over half of Android users are on year-old version of the operating system. Apple users never have the luxury of using an old version because they are forced to buy a new model every year as one of the commands of their religion.

He has a reason to be upset. Samsung knocked Apple off its perch atop the global smartphone arena in 2012, and continues to chip away at its market share with a combination of aggressive marketing and rapid technology adoption. It also has produced better machines than Apple with apps that actually work. Siri only works in the US and Apple's maps are so broken that police actually warn people off from using it.

Rather than compete with products, Apple has attempted to sue Samsung off the shelves with patent trollage. This has failed too.

Schiller said the fragmentation, or the number of versions of the Android operating system out in the marketplace, is a problem.

The Samsung Galaxy S4 is rumoured to ship with an OS that is nearly a year old, he moaned. "Customers will have to wait to get an update".
